Do I need to be a US citizen or resident?+
No. Founders from anywhere in the world can own a US LLC or C-Corp. You do not need a visa, a Social Security Number or a US address. PowerLaunch provides the address and the registered agent.
How long does formation take?+
Filing takes one to three business days in Wyoming, Kentucky and Colorado, and one to two weeks in most other states. The EIN follows, usually within two to four weeks for non-resident owners, or within days with expedited processing.
Which state should I choose?+
Wyoming for most online businesses: low fees, no state income tax, strong privacy. Delaware if you plan to raise venture capital as a C-Corp. Your own state if you live in the US. The checkout recommends one from three questions.
LLC or C-Corp?+
An LLC is simpler and cheaper to run and is right for consulting, e-commerce, SaaS and agencies. A C-Corp suits founders raising from US investors or planning stock options. Both are available on every plan.

Can I open a US bank account?+
Yes. Once your EIN arrives we introduce you to Mercury, Wise Business or Relay. Approval is the bank's decision, and most PowerLaunch founders are approved within a week.
Can I use Stripe?+
Yes. A US LLC with an EIN and a US bank account can open a Stripe account and accept cards worldwide.
What filings does a non-resident owned LLC have every year?+
Federal: Form 5472 with a pro forma 1120 by 15 April. State: an annual report or franchise tax, depending on the state. Run and Scale include both.
Do I need to file a BOI report?+
Under the current FinCEN rule, companies formed in the US are exempt from beneficial ownership reporting. We track the rule and will tell you if it changes.
